Locals were once called Tarboilers, but legend has it that in then Civil War, residents from Virginia were taunting soldiers from North Carolina and asked, Any more tar down in the Old North State, boys? They replied, Not a bit, its all been brought up. Then they made a joke that the regiment leader was going to put the tar on the heels of the Virginians to make them stick better in the fight! An "Alaskan" of course! 350Lake Forest, IL 60045, 33 N. County St., Ste. Mencken wrote in the 1936 edition of American Language, For many years Hoboken was the joke-town of New York. Hoboken was also used in New York and Massachusetts as a euphemistic stand-in for Hell..
